Kentwell Hall is a striking Tudor manor house located in Long Melford, Suffolk, United Kingdom. Renowned for its impressive architecture and historical significance, the estate dates back to the 16th century. The hall is surrounded by a moat and set within extensive gardens and parkland, providing a picturesque setting. Kentwell Hall is well-known for its living history events, where visitors can experience life as it would have been in Tudor times through interactive reenactments. The estate also features a variety of outbuildings, including a working farm, a rare breeds area, and a walled garden.
